What is Rent Reporting?
Before we jump in, let’s clarify what rent reporting really is. Imagine your rent payments are like the fuel that keeps your financial engine running. Each time you pay your rent on time, that positive behavior can be reported and recorded in your credit report—just like paying your credit card bill. This, in turn, can enhance your credit score!

1. Boost Your Credit Score Quickly
One of the primary benefits of rent reporting is that it can boost your credit score. Many people don’t realize that on-time rent payments can be recognized in your credit history. This is especially crucial for young adults who may not have a long credit history yet.

2. Build a Strong Credit History
Your credit score is based on your credit history. By adding your rent payments, you’re expanding this history. Think of it like adding more entries to your resume. The more positive experiences you have (like paying rent on time), the stronger your overall profile becomes.
3. Secure Lower Interest Rates
With a higher credit score, you become a less risky borrower in the eyes of lenders. This means you can qualify for lower interest rates on loans and credit cards. Picture this: borrowing money will cost you less over time, making your future purchases more affordable!
4. Improve Rental Applications
When you apply for a new apartment, landlords often conduct credit checks. A solid credit score can give you a better chance of securing your desired place. It shows landlords you’re reliable and trustworthy—just like a glowing recommendation from a previous employer.
